can you read the knock sensor when it gets knock with a voltmeter or is the voltage to small or fast ect.

the voltage spikes are too fast to see with a voltmeter, and would be hard to scale anyway. the computer uses a table with knock volts vs rpm to determine what voltage constitutes a knock event at a given rpm, since it varies.

Before the computer 'sees' the knock signal, the output of the sensor is ran through a band-pass filter, (I believe 2kHz - 5 kHz), to filter out all the garbage. Monitoring knock is do-able, but one would need advanced electronic skills.
